The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• adj. Relating to, consisting of, or covered with wool.
  • adj. Resembling wool.
  • adj. Lacking sharp detail or clarity: woolly television reception.
  • adj. Mentally or intellectually disorganized or unclear: woolly thinking.
  • adj. Having the characteristics of the rough, generally lawless atmosphere of the American frontier: wild and woolly.
  • n. A garment made of wool, especially an undergarment of knitted wool.
  • n. Australian A sheep.
